10 things you'll realise during your first year at university

I am suddenly at the end of my first year at University - where have the past 8 months gone!? Once you move in halls and start living the 'uni life,' there are a few things you'll realise. I've compiled a list of the 10 things I have discovered since moving to Southampton. Hope you enjoy!


1) Freshers flu is the worst. Especially when all of your course mates and flatmates have it too- there's no escape. It will also take you a good month or so to finally feel better.

2) Use by dates don't really matter as much. Does it smell ok? Does it look ok? If yes, then go for it.

3) You can function on hardly any sleep. Who needs to sleep at night anyway? That's what number 4 is for.

4) NAPS ARE THE BEST. They will become your best friend. Feeling tired? Nap. Got work to do? Nap. Simple.

 5) You will miss your family more than you think. Especially when you're unwell, stressed, or when you're hungry and poor.

6) Washing clothes takes forever, and isn't exactly cheap. Going back and forth from the laundry room is effort too. There's also the fear that your clothes will get nicked or that someone will say "are those your underwear on the floor?" after you've dropped them en route.

7) Receiving the parcel list is the happiest part of your day. An ASOS parcel can always make your day 1000x better.

8) Freshers fair will set you up with some pretty cool stuff. For example; a years supply of pens, a rape alarm, and the occasional stress ball (because what uni student doesn't need one of those?!)

9) You're no Nigella Lawson or Gordon Ramsay - but that's ok. As long as you can cook pasta then you're sorted. It's also ok to burn toast and set the fire alarm off, you're not alone. (But don't admit it was you when everyone from your halls is standing outside in the freezing cold.)

10) Your flatmates will become your family. You can go to them when you're sad, bored, or can't
sleep and they're always there for you.
